Palliative Care 'Coverage' in Kyrgyzstan

In 2005, the ratio of hospice/palliative care services in Kyrgyzstan was one service per 2.65 million inhabitants (see Table 3). This compares to one service per 2.45 million inhabitants in 2002.15

Table 3: Ratio of hospice/palliative care services per million population; Commonwealth of Independent States (plus Mongolia) (2005).

Armenia

1: 0.09m

Azerbaijan

1: 8.32m

Belarus

1: 0.81m

Georgia

1: 1.11m

Kazakhstan

1: 1.28m

Kyrgyzstan

1: 2.65m

Mongolia

1: 2.65m

Republic of Moldova

1: 0.27m

Russian Federation

1: 1.15m

Tajikistan

0: 6.53m

Turkmenistan

0: 6.56m

Ukraine

1: 2.59m

Uzbekistan

0: 26.01m

Source: EAPC Taskforce on the Development of Palliative Care in Europe (2005) A Map of Palliative Care Specific Resources in Europe. 4th Research Forum of the European Association for Palliative Care, Venice, Italy, 25th-27th May 2006/ Clark, D., and Wright, M. (2003) Transitions in End of Life Care: Hospice and Related Developments in Eastern Europe and Central Asia. Buckingham: Open University Press.
